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
69010681 14407076991 8985805724 01857629216
38 27655734712
38 27655734712
77000340090 301081834 8135 987085629 36025
All about undefined
Interested in learning more?
38 27655734712
77000340090 301081834 8135 987085629 36025
See more
40507466 0658734 8996
4131 641 73
See more
28710921 7663 899614
9432 5656142664 372
See more